BRIDGEWATER, N.J. – The NEC released its 2025 Women's Soccer Preseason Poll on Tuesday afternoon. The FDU Knights were picked to finish second by the league's coaches and garnered four first-place votes.
The lofty expectations surrounding the Knights come as no surprise. With 10 of 11 starters returning from the 2024 squad that battled its way back to the NEC Championship match, FDU enters 2025 with the program's third conference title in its sights.
Four of those starters earned First Team All-NEC recognition last year, while two others landed on the All-Rookie Team. Seniors
Mona Schlegl and
Andrea Ougaard lead the way, supported by the junior trio of
Ana Salas,
Laura Martinez, and
Katia Cardaba—each entering their third year as a mainstay in the lineup. Sophomores
Marina Burzaco,
Elena Cvetkovic,
Elisa Garcia, and
Rosemarie LeBlanc also return after playing pivotal roles in the team's 2024 success.
To paint the picture in numbers: the Knights bring back 26 of 32 goals and 73 of 89 total points. The 32 goals scored marked the program's highest single-season total since 2017. With the bulk of production returning—and an extra game added to the conference slate—FDU is in prime position to eclipse those numbers in 2025.
Head Coach
Eric Teepe returns for his 12th season on the sidelines in Teaneck, already cemented as the program's all-time winningest coach with 100 career victories. Alongside much of the returning core, Teepe also welcomes back assistant coach
Elma Kolenovic for her second season at her alma mater.
The only team picked ahead of the Knights in the preseason poll is reigning champion Howard. The Burgundy and Blue fell twice on the road to the Bison last season, including in the NEC final. This fall, Howard will travel to FDU on November 3 for the regular-season finale.
NEC Women's Soccer Preseason Poll
- Howard (7)
- FDU (4)
- Wagner (1)
- CCSU
- Stonehill
- LIU
- Saint Francis U
- Mercyhurst
- Le Moyne
- New Haven
- Chicago State
- Delaware State
The 2025 season kicks off on August 17 when the Knights face Boston College in Newton, Mass. FDU's home opener in Teaneck is set for September 4 against Penn.
